About The Position

Genmab is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Digital Risk Management Intern to support the company’s digital risk and third-party security management initiatives. This internship offers hands-on experience in vendor risk assessment, digital risk tracking, and information security governance. The intern will play an active role in helping evaluate vendor security postures, maintain the digital risk register, and contributing to continuous improvement of Genmab’s risk governance framework. This internship offers valuable exposure to digital risk management and third-party security practices, providing hands-on experience in risk analysis, governance frameworks, and control assessments. Interns will also benefit from mentorship and learning opportunities in both the information security and risk management domains, gaining practical insights into how cybersecurity and governance operate within a global organization.

Requirements

  • The ideal candidate is a student working towards their undergraduate degree in Information Security, Computer Science, Cybersecurity, Risk Management or a related engineering field
  • The ideal candidate should have the ability to be detail-oriented, eager to learn, and possess a foundational understanding of cybersecurity

Nice To Haves

  • Some understanding of security tools and platforms such as GRC systems (e.g., ServiceNow GRC), vulnerability scanners (e.g., Tenable or Defender), and SIEMs (e.g., Sentinel) would be a plus
  • Prior knowledge and ability to interpret security reports (e.g., SOC 2 Type II, penetration testing summaries, vulnerability scans etc.) would be a plus

Responsibilities

  • Assist with third-party due diligence reviews, including assessing vendor security documentation and learning how to identify control gaps
  • Learn ServiceNow GRC module and then support risk owners in documenting risk treatment plans and tracking mitigation activities
  • Learn to conduct independent analysis of the risk register to identify patterns, trends, or areas requiring attention
  • Contribute to the enhancement of information security policies, processes, and controls as part of the governance framework
  • Participate in learning sessions and team meetings to strengthen understanding of cyber risk management practices
  • Independently research options to mitigate control gaps related to open critical or high risks
  • Learn and then independently develop custom GPTs to enhance productivity
